The Rise of a Powerhouse: Spencer Jones' Debut Homerun

In the world of baseball, where legends are made and broken, a new star is emerging, and his name is Spencer Jones. This young talent has just given us a glimpse of what's to come with a jaw-dropping debut home run.

Jones, a highly anticipated prospect, made his mark on the field with a 443-foot blast, a distance that would make any slugger proud. What makes this feat even more impressive is the speed at which the ball left his bat—a staggering 112.2 mph! This combination of power and velocity is a rare sight, and it's no wonder it has caught the attention of fans and analysts alike.

A Prodigious Talent

As a top prospect for the Yankees, Jones has been known for his raw power, and this recent display only solidifies his reputation. His Minor League career boasts an impressive 85 home runs, a testament to his ability to consistently send balls out of the park. However, the transition to the big leagues can be challenging, and Jones has faced his fair share of struggles.

One of the most intriguing aspects of Jones' game is his 'nitro zone,' a sweet spot in his swing that, when pitched to, can result in explosive outcomes. This was evident in his recent at-bat, where a cutter right down the middle became a victim of his mighty swing.
